In just one verse, Psalm 100:3 reminds us of a profound truth – that we are not here by chance but by divine design. We are not products of random processes but intentionally crafted by the hands of our Creator.
First, this verse encourages us to "Know that the Lord is God." It calls us to recognize and acknowledge the sovereignty of God. He is the supreme, all-powerful, and all-knowing Creator of the universe. This knowledge should lead us to humble ourselves before Him, recognizing His authority over our lives.
Second, the verse declares, "He made us." This emphasizes the intimate act of creation. God carefully formed us, intricately designing every detail of our being. Our uniqueness is a testament to His craftsmanship. We are not accidents; we are purposefully created.
Third, the verse reminds us, "We are his; we are his people, the sheep of his pasture." We belong to God. We are not alone in this world but part of His flock. Just as a shepherd cares for his sheep, God lovingly tends to our needs, guides us, and provides for us. We are not abandoned or forgotten; our Heavenly Father cherishes us.
This verse invites us to reflect on our profound relationship with our Creator. It's a relationship built on love, care, and purpose. As we go about our daily lives, remember that we are not aimless wanderers but valued members of God's flock. Let's embrace this truth with gratitude and live in a way that honors the One who made us.
